Musical Mobilities: Son Jarocho and the Circulation of Tradition Across Mexico and the United States - Routledge Advances in Ethnography Alejandro Nieto 1st edition
Musical Mobilities: Son Jarocho and the Circulation of Tradition Across Mexico and the United States - Routledge Advances in Ethnography
Alejandro Nieto
Musical Mobilities analyses how a musical tradition moves, literally and metaphorically: the ways in which people, objects and information travel across geographical locations, just as practices as recognisable entities circulate along with meanings, competencies and embodied dispositions.
